The gap between Labour and National could be starting to widen, as election day gets closer.
The latest Newshub-Reid Research poll shows National and Act both up with enough support to see them form a Government
Labour has dropped 3.6 points to 32.3 percent, but the Greens are up to 9.6 percent.
Former MP turned political commentator Peter Dunne says Labour's dip is reflective of other polls.
He says over the last few months, there's been a wider gap between the right and left.
